Got an email around 6 o’clock from a guy called Blake asking if he and his wife could join a tapas tour this evening. And well, aside from the fact that I am not giving tours yet, it was very last minute, even too late for José to get into Sevilla on time (he lives just outside town). So I had to apologise and say no… twice, because he wrote back saying they were vaccinated, etc. But I explained it was too late to organise anything and once again had to say no. Then he wrote AGAIN saying that if I changed my mind to just let them know. And then inspiration struck! I remembered when, a few years ago, friends were visiting and I was hit with a random 24-hour bug. I suddenly had to take to my bed and wasn’t able to meet up with them. Instead we stayed in touch by phone and I told them where to go and what to order. And so I decided to suggest this to Blake (especially as he clearly wasn’t taking no for an answer! 😉 ).

Well, he loved the idea and I set it up like a bit of a mystery tour, sending them map locations of the bars by WhatsApp one at a time, with a list of tapas to order at each one. Meanwhile they sent me photos (and bad jokes courtesy of Blake) throughout the evening. Later he sent me this message.   🙂

One of the best travel experiences I have had, thank you so much again and I can’t wait to write my review tomorrow. Cheers.

I was joking that I could maybe do this full-time, doing 3-4 tours a night sending people to different bars while I stay home and netflix with the cats, but the truth is I can’t wait to get out and about again. This was fun though!

I’ve never paid attention to this before but apparently every year or so there are new electricity tariffs and different “plans”. This latest one comes into effect today and apparently I can save money by trying to restrict my usage to the green “valle”  and yellow “llano” hours. I mean, looks great for weekends and national holidays but weekdays are going to require planning. Such as only firing up the washing machine or dishwasher at 6 AM when I get up to feed the cats (and no I can’t just put them on when I go to bed, especially the dishwasher, but that’s another story). And so that’s easy enough, as the idea is to stay away from the red “punta” times, but I mean… how can I not put on my AC between 6-10 PM during the blazing hot summer?? I practiced yesterday, having it on 4-6 PM to cool the place down and then just relying on my electric fans (with windows shut) until bedtime. And it was okay, but it sure ain’t gonna work July-August. Yeah I know… but there’s not much else going on to talk about.  😉
